On 27.09.23 21:20, Adhemerval Zanella wrote:
> If the binary to run is 'env', test-containers skips it and adds
> any required environment variable on the process envs variables.
> This simplifies the required code to spawn new process (no need
> to build an env-like program).
> 
> However, this is an issue for recursive_remove if there is any
> LD_PRELOAD, since test-container will not prepend the loader command
> along with required paths.  If the required preloaded library can
> not be loaded by the system glibc, the 'post-clean rsync' will
> eventually fail.
> 
> One example is if system glibc does not support DT_RELR and the
> built glibc does, the nss/tst-nss-gai-hv2-canonname test fails
> with:
> 
> ../scripts/evaluate-test.sh nss/tst-nss-gai-hv2-canonname $? false false
> 86_64-linux-gnu/nss/tst-nss-gai-hv2-canonname.test-result
> rm: /lib/x86_64-linux-gnu/libc.so.6: version `GLIBC_ABI_DT_RELR' not
> found (required by x86_64-linux-gnu/malloc/libc_malloc_debug.so)
> 
> Instead trying to figure out the required loader arguments on how
> to spawn the 'rm -rf', replace the command with a nftw call.
> 
Just as information, I've also recognized this issue. For me (on
x86_64/s390x), I got "*** stack smashing detected ***: terminated" in
this rm due to preloading with the fresh build libc_malloc_debug.so.
In malloc_hook_ini -> generic_hook_ini -> initialize_malloc_check, we have:
TUNABLE_GET (check, int32_t, TUNABLE_CALLBACK (set_mallopt_check));
In __tunable_get_val, the tunables ID from current-build and system for
glibc.malloc.check differs. In my case it is 30, which is beyond the
range of the systems tunable_list[]. This leads to storing a 8byte value
to passed valp. Unfortunately it points to a 4 byte int32_t and the
other 4 bytes belong to the stack smashing canary.

Your patch solves the issue for me.

> diff --git a/support/test-container.c b/support/test-container.c
> index 788b091ea0..95dfef1a99 100644
> --- a/support/test-container.c
> +++ b/support/test-container.c
> @@ -37,6 +37,7 @@
>  #include <errno.h>
>  #include <error.h>
>  #include <libc-pointer-arith.h>
> +#include <ftw.h>
> 
>  #ifdef __linux__
>  #include <sys/mount.h>
> @@ -405,32 +406,19 @@ file_exists (char *path)
>    return 0;
>  }
> 
> +static int
> +unlink_cb (const char *fpath, const struct stat *sb, int typeflag,
> +	   struct FTW *ftwbuf)
> +{
> +  return remove (fpath);
> +}
> +
>  static void
>  recursive_remove (char *path)
>  {
> -  pid_t child;
> -  int status;
> -
> -  child = fork ();
> -
> -  switch (child) {
> -  case -1:
> -    perror("fork");
> -    FAIL_EXIT1 ("Unable to fork");
> -  case 0:
> -    /* Child.  */
> -    execlp ("rm", "rm", "-rf", path, NULL);
> -    FAIL_EXIT1 ("exec rm: %m");
> -  default:
> -    /* Parent.  */
> -    waitpid (child, &status, 0);
> -    /* "rm" would have already printed a suitable error message.  */
> -    if (! WIFEXITED (status)
> -	|| WEXITSTATUS (status) != 0)
> -      FAIL_EXIT1 ("exec child returned status: %d", status);
> -
> -    break;
> -  }
> +  int r = nftw (path, unlink_cb, 1000, FTW_DEPTH | FTW_PHYS);
> +  if (r == -1)
> +    FAIL_EXIT1 ("recursive_remove failed");
>  }
